The sermon “Bind Up Their Wounds” by President Henry B. Eyring made me realize that compassion is a precious feeling; acting upon it each time we feel it increases our abilities to feel and act upon it. That is a virtue cycle, where acting upon a virtue increases the virtue. .
“In the Lord’s words the Samaritan, when he saw the wounded man, stopped because ‘he had compassion.’
“More than only feeling compassion, he acted.”
